2011-04-07 68 views
0

首先我剛剛擁有一臺android並嘗試開發android應用程序。我注意到,有時在應用程序和本地android應用程序中,有時當您長按或有時只是點擊菜單出現。這個菜單不像上下文菜單bc沒有標題。只是一個白色的選項列表,在其他人看來,它是完全自定義的,但再一次沒有黑色欄的標題。如果有人知道這個觀點的名字,你可以讓我知道。謝謝關於Android的問題查看

回答

0

你是對的ContextMenus只顯示在長按。您看到的其他內容都是Dialog或自定義視圖。如果你想完全自主的某種菜單中,你也可以只使用一個Dialog並添加你希望每個視圖元素 http://developer.android.com/guide/topics/ui/menus.html

:你這樣定義的Android開發者文章中描述的菜單。

0

它實際上是一個上下文菜單......唯一的區別是它沒有標題。看看registerForContextMenu

+0

所以有兩個問題,你可以創建一個上下文菜單沒有長按。我認爲這是實施它們的唯一方法。另外爲了定製它們,我必須擴展一個視圖或者在那裏構建函數。例如,如果我想要的不僅僅是文本,也許是上下文菜單中的一行文本和圖像。 – auwall 2011-04-07 14:00:55

+0

是的,你可以...看看這個:http://developer.android.com/guide/topics/ui/menus.html – Cristian 2011-04-07 14:46:00